Mercedes readies new 4Matic for transverse fwd architecture

02-Jan-2013 20:00 GMT
Set to launch on the 2014 CLA 45 AMG, a high-performance A-segment car, the new 4Matic features fully variable torque distribution and a PTO integrated into the 7-speed DCT. Read full story

A new approach to Li-ion battery modeling
16-Dec-2012 23:15 GMT
The new approach of researchers at Battery Design LLC and CD-adapco avoids the limitations of the standard approach by resolving the structure of the electrode and explicitly modeling the transport of lithium in the electrolyte and solid phases. Read full story

Acura RLX shows advanced rear-steer, engine technology
11-Dec-2012 19:52 GMT
The luxury sedan has rear steering with a separate motor at each wheel, and its new engine features I-VTEC valvetrain integrated electronically with re-engineered control of a cylinder deactivation system and computer-controlled engine mounts. Read full story
2014 Subaru Forester includes direct-injection turbo
11-Dec-2012 19:13 GMT
Base engine is 2.5-L naturally aspirated unit, and fuel economy is up 17% and highway number is 32 mpg as Subaru replaces four-speed automatic with CVT that has adaptive learning. The 2.0-L turbo is rated at 250 hp (187 kW). Vehicle size is almost unchanged, but rear-seat legroom is increased and cargo area is larger. Read full story
